Administrative history
The Ancaster Ministerial Association is a voluntary organization with its membership drawn from ministers serving the Christian churches of Ancaster. The first meeting of the re-organized association was held on 10 March 1964. The association has been active in planning joint services, making political statements, issuing advertising, and providing programming and studies.

Scope and content
Ffonds consists of minutes, correspondence, orders of service, marriage preparation course materials, and a community study of Ancaster.
